Course Details
- Unit 1: Introduction to LGBTQ+ History in the Caribbean
- Unit 2: Historical Context: Colonialism and its Impact on Caribbean LGBTQ+ Identity
- Unit 3: The Role of Religion in Shaping Caribbean LGBTQ+ Experiences
- Unit 4: Key Figures and Movements in Caribbean LGBTQ+ History
- Unit 5: Legal Landscape: LGBTQ+ Rights and Advocacy in the Caribbean
- Unit 6: Caribbean LGBTQ+ Literature and Cultural Expression
- Unit 7: Intersectionality: Race, Gender, and Sexuality in the Caribbean LGBTQ+ Community
- Unit 8: Modern Challenges and Opportunities for the Caribbean LGBTQ+ Movement
- Unit 9: Case Studies: Examining LGBTQ+ Experiences in Select Caribbean Countries
- Unit 10: The Future of LGBTQ+ Activism and Inclusion in the Caribbean
